Abstract

The invention discloses a flying fiber detection method for machine room inspection, and relates to the technical field of switch detection. The method comprises the following steps of: acquiring a switch image in a normal optical fiber port state and an optical fiber tidy state as a detection template, acquiring a template image of each port of the switch according to the detection template, and aligning the image of the detection template and the image of the switch to be detected by utilizing ORB characteristics; marking the port position in the switch image needing to be detected according to the template image of each port, matching the port position in the detection template with the port position in the switch image needing to be detected by using a dynamic programming algorithm, if the matching succeeds, indicating that the port is correctly inserted, and if the matching fails, indicating that the port is wrongly inserted. And according to the detection template, carrying out classification detection on the condition that the optical fibers are arranged irregularly by utilizing an SVM classification model aiming at a switch image needing to be detected.

Background technique [0002] Flying fiber detection is to identify the flying fiber ports on the switch and determine whether the ports on the fiber are inserted incorrectly, or if the plug is not inserted correctly, and at the same time, it detects whether the fibers are not neatly arranged. [0003] In the task of computer room inspection, it is necessary to perform flying fiber detection on switches. Flying fiber detection is very important in the inspection of the computer room, which requires a lot of manpower and time. At present, there is no relevant method to solve this problem efficiently and reduce manpower and material resources. loss.
